Responsibilities

  • Provide customer service to personnel and visitors at a logistics and distribution location by carrying out security-related procedures, site-specific policies, and when appropriate, emergency response activities.
  • Control access at entry and exit points by verifying identification, checking authorization for entry, and directing drivers, employees, and visitors to the proper check-in and/or loading areas.
  • Monitor inbound and outbound vehicle and trailer traffic, assist with gate operations, and document arrivals, departures, and irregular activity per post orders.
  • Respond to incidents and critical situations in a calm, problem-solving manner, including communicating with site contacts and notifying Allied Universal supervision as required.
  • Conduct regular and random patrols of the building, yard, and perimeter to help to deter unauthorized access and/or suspicious activity, and report concerns per site procedures.
